个推平台API使用经验

前言

      移动Push推送是移动互联网最基础的需求之一,用于满足移动互联环境下消息到达App客户端。以转转(58赶集旗下真实个人的闲置交易平台)为例,当买家下单后,我们通过移动Push推送消息告诉卖家,当卖家已经发货时,我们通过移动Push消息告诉买家,让买卖双方及时掌握二手商品交易的实时订单动态。

        实现推送功能的方案有许多,具体可以看《程序员》的一篇文章http://geek.csdn.net/news/detail/58738,这里也详解了IOS与Android接受推送的机制不同。

本文主要讲的是利用第三方平台来开发个推功能的API,使用的个推平台:http://www.getui.com/

         具体的使用流程,如何绑定APP在官网的官方文档里已经详细给出,这个都是操作问题,不涉及到后台的开发。官方文档里已经给出了API介绍,但是使用的需求API提供的信息远远超出了API介绍的范围。下面我将从设计的角度给出一个DEMO。

DEMO

需求:web端/APP端给指定群体用户发送一条通知,使用客户端登录APP的指定用户都能收到通知(支持多终端登录),在菜单栏显示通知,点击通知转到APP内(透传)显示通知详情(无论APP离线还是在线);

设计:
类:
loginUserPojo(用户类)
NotificationPojo(通知类)--属性见数据库设计信息表
                   


数据库表的设计:
user_login(user_id,user_name,password....)
nofitication(notification_id,title,content,createDt,creator_user_id....)
user_device(user_id,client_id,device_token)(ios个推信息通过device_id发送,andorid通过client_id发送)
个推API设计:
1.基本配置信息类
public class GeXinBaseInfo {
    //以下三个属性每个APP不同
    static String appId = "VAn4M36ciG9mGBEQwuDxV5";
    static String appkey = "HSlKLGNZ8e6RChB3JCIop9";
    static String master = "CUEIVtxSdL6wO9GfRxFoZ1";
    //host是固定的作为个推的服务器
    static String host = "http://sdk.open.api.igexin.com/serviceex";
    static long offExpireTime = 24 * 1000 * 3600;

    //透传消息设置,1为强制启动应用,客户端接收到消息后就会立即启动应用;2为等待应用启动
    static int TYPE_LAUNCH_APP = 1;
    static int TYPE_WAIT_FOR_CLICK = 2;
}

2.安卓端接收信息类(点击通知后,app端根据ID信息获取通知详情)

public class TransimissionContentPojo implements Serializable{

    //通知的id
    private String contentId;

    //其它属性。。。
    //private ...
    public String getContentId() {
               return contentId;
    }

    public void setContentId(String contentId) {
               this.contentId = contentId;
    }
}

3.创建通知信息的工厂类
public class NotiTemplateFactory {
     //andorid
    public static NotificationTemplate produceNotiFromNoti(NotificationPojo notificationPojo){
        NotificationTemplate template = getBaseTemplate();
        template.setTitle("移动校园");
        template.setText(notificationPojo.getTitle());
        template.setTransmissionType(1);
        TransimissionContentPojo pojo = new TransimissionContentPojo();
        pojo.setContentId(notificationPojo.getNotificationId());
        template.setTransmissionContent(new Gson().toJson(pojo));
        return template;
    }
    //ios
    public static APNPayload.DictionaryAlertMsg getDictionaryAlertMsg(String title, NotificationPojo nPojo){
        	APNPayload.DictionaryAlertMsg alertMsg = new APNPayload.DictionaryAlertMsg();
        	alertMsg.setBody(title);
        	alertMsg.setTitle("移动校园");
        	alertMsg.setTitleLocKey("ccccc");
        	alertMsg.setActionLocKey("移动校园");
        	return alertMsg;
    	}
}

4.个推发送信息工具类

public class GeXinMPushUtil {
    private static GeXinMPushUtil instance;

    private static ExecutorService executorService;

    private List<Target> convertToTargets(List<String> cidList) {
        List<Target> targetList = new ArrayList<>();
        for (String cid : cidList) {
            Target target = new Target();
            target.setAppId(GeXinBaseInfo.appId);
            target.setClientId(cid);
//          target.setAlias(cid);
            targetList.add(target);
        }
        return targetList;
    }

    protected IGtPush push;

    public GeXinMPushUtil() {
        push = new IGtPush(GeXinBaseInfo.host, GeXinBaseInfo.appkey, GeXinBaseInfo.master);
        executorService = Executors.newCachedThreadPool();
    }

    public static GeXinMPushUtil getInstance() {
        if (instance == null) {
            instance = new GeXinMPushUtil();
        }
        return instance;
    }
   
    //andorid有通知
    public void push(final NotificationTemplate notificationTemplate, final List<String> cidList) {

        executorService.submit(new Runnable() {
            @Override
            public void run() {
                ListMessage message = new ListMessage();
                message.setData(notificationTemplate);
                message.setOffline(true);
                message.setOfflineExpireTime(GeXinBaseInfo.offExpireTime);
                String taskId = push.getContentId(message);
                IPushResult ret = push.pushMessageToList(taskId, convertToTargets(cidList));
                System.out.println(ret.getResponse().toString());
            }
        });
    }
    
    //andorid透传,无通知
    public void push(final TransmissionTemplate transmissionTemplate, final List<String> cidList) {

        executorService.submit(new Runnable() {
            @Override
            public void run() {
                ListMessage message = new ListMessage();
                message.setData(transmissionTemplate);
                message.setOffline(false);
                message.setOfflineExpireTime(GeXinBaseInfo.offExpireTime);
                String taskId = push.getContentId(message);
                IPushResult ret = push.pushMessageToList(taskId, convertToTargets(cidList));
                System.out.println(ret.getResponse().toString());

            }
        });
    }
    

   //将用户ID与client_id绑定记录在个推服务上
    public boolean bind(String alias, String cid){
        IAliasResult bindSCid = push.bindAlias(GeXinBaseInfo.appId, alias, cid);
        return bindSCid.getResult();
    }
    

    //解绑
    public boolean unBind(String alias, String cid){
        IAliasResult unBindSCid = push.unBindAlias(GeXinBaseInfo.appId, alias, cid);
        return unBindSCid.getResult();
    }
    
    //ios推送
    public void pushAPN(final APNPayload.DictionaryAlertMsg alertMsg
            , final List<String> deviceTokens, String content){
                IGtPush push = new IGtPush(GeXinBaseInfo.host,
                        GeXinBaseInfo.appkey, GeXinBaseInfo.master);

                APNTemplate t = new APNTemplate();

                APNPayload apnpayload = new APNPayload();
                apnpayload.setSound("");

                apnpayload.setAlertMsg(alertMsg);
              //传送的附加信息,用于解析
                apnpayload.addCustomMsg("info",content);
                t.setAPNInfo(apnpayload);
                ListMessage message = new ListMessage();
                message.setData(t);
                IPushResult ret = push.pushAPNMessageToList(GeXinBaseInfo.appId, contentId, deviceTokens);
                System.out.println(ret.getResponse());
    }
}








逻辑设计:
用户登录andorid携带client_id,iOS端携带device_token,检查user_device中是否有记录user_id与 client_id或user_id与device_token的组合,如果没有插入组合,并且绑定这组信息
public UserInfoJson login(HttpServletRequest request,
                              HttpServletResponse response) {
        String userName = request.getParameter("userName");
        String password = request.getParameter("passWord");
        String clientId = request.getParameter("clientId");
        String deviceId = request.getParameter("deviceToken");
        LoginUserPojo user = loginUserService.findByUserCode(userName);
        if (user == null) {
            return new UserInfoJson();
        } else {
            UserInfoJson userJson = getUserJson(user);
            //绑定用户与硬件
            if (clientId != null && !clientId.trim().equals("")) {
                userJson.setClientId(clientId);
                int count = loginUserService.selectDeviceByClientId(user.getUserId(), clientId);
                if (count == 0) {
                    GeXinMPushUtil.getInstance().bind(user.getUserId(), clientId);
                    loginUserService.insertDeviceByClientId(user.getUserId(), clientId);
                }
            }
            if (deviceId != null && !deviceId.trim().equals("")) {
                userJson.setDeviceId(deviceId);
                int count = loginUserService.selectDeviceByDeviceId(user.getUserId(), deviceId);
                if (count == 0) {
                    loginUserService.insertDeviceByDeviceId(user.getUserId(), deviceId);
                }
            }
            String encPassword = new SimpleHash("md5", password, new SimpleByteSourceFix(user.getSalt()), 2).toHex();
            if (!encPassword.equals(user.getPassword())) {
                return new UserInfoJson();
            } else {
                userJson.setToken(encPassword);
                return userJson;
            }
        }
    }

注销登录:


public boolean loginOut(HttpServletRequest request,
                              HttpServletResponse response) {
        String userId = request.getParameter("userId");
        String clientId = request.getParameter("clientId");
        String deviceId = request.getParameter("deviceToken");
        boolean result = false;
       //取消绑定
if (clientId != null && !clientId.trim().equals(""))
            loginUserService.deleteDeviceByClientId(userId, deviceId);
            result = GeXinMPushUtil.getInstance().unBind(userId, clientId);
        if (deviceId != null) {
            try {
                loginUserService.deleteDeviceByDeviceId(userId, deviceId);
                result = true;
            } catch (Exception e){
                result = false;
                e.printStackTrace();
            }
        }

        return result;
    }


在发送通知的方法中,加入推送的代码:
..............前面的代码用户获取NotificationPojo nPojo(通知内容),
    List<String> sendUsers(发送的用户ID)
    List<String> listAlias = new ArrayList<>();
                if (sendUsers != null && !sendUsers.isEmpty()) {
                    for (LoginUserPojo userPojo : sendUsers) {
                        // TODO: 16/1/26 getui these users
                        listAlias.add(userPojo.getUserId());
                    }
                }
                List<String> deviceTokens = new ArrayList<>();
                List<String> clientIds = new ArrayList<>();
                if (listAlias != null && !listAlias.isEmpty() && listAlias.size() != 0) {
                    deviceTokens = loginUserService.selectDeviceTokens(listAlias);
                    clientIds = loginUserService.selectClientIds(listAlias);
                }
                TransimissionContentPojo pojo = new TransimissionContentPojo(TransimissionContentPojo.TYPE_NOTI);
                pojo.setContentId(notificationPojo.getNotificationId());
                NotificationTemplate template = NotiTemplateFactory.produceNotiFromNoti(notificationPojo);
                if (clientIds.size() != 0 && !clientIds.isEmpty())
                    GeXinMPushUtil.getInstance().push(template, clientIds);
                APNPayload.DictionaryAlertMsg alertMsg = NotiTemplateFactory.getDictionaryAlertMsg(notificationPojo.getTitle()
                        ,notificationPojo);
                if (deviceTokens.size() != 0 && !deviceTokens.isEmpty())
                    GeXinMPushUtil.getInstance().pushAPN(alertMsg, deviceTokens,new Gson().toJson(pojo));

.................这样就可以将推送信息发送出去了

其中
selectDeviceTokens(List<String>  alias)的mybatis代码如下:
(使用MyBatis的sql如下
     <select id="selectDeviceTokens" resultType="java.lang.String">
		select device_id
		from user_device
		where device_id is not null and user_id in
		<foreach collection="userIds" item="userId" index="index"
				 open="(" close=")" separator=",">
			#{userId}
		</foreach>
	</select>)




对于附加信息,contentId的发送,app的获取,安卓端的获取凡事:msg.content-------此内容为new Gson().toJson(pojo)的Json字符串,可以解析获取contentId的内容,然后更具contentId获取Notification的详情(发送一次请求,sql查询)
而IOS的处理比较复杂,msg.payload.info-----此内容为new Gson().toJson(pojo)的Json字符串,因为IOS服务端发送的是ListMessage,这是对应msg,listMessage设置了payLoad,payLoad设置了info(apnpayload.addCustomMsg("info",content);),因此提取额外信息是msg.payload.info,info这个字端是在服务器端设置的,当然也可以是其它名称。
